multiplexing
Multiplexing is the simultaneous sending of multiple information streams over a communications medium as a single, complex signal that is then recovered at the receiving end. Continue Reading

ICMP (Internet Control Message Protocol)
ICMP (Internet Control Message Protocol) is an error-reporting and message-control protocol that network devices use to report problems in IP packet delivery.Continue Reading
millimeter wave (MM wave)
Millimeter wave (also millimeter band) is the band of spectrum between 30 gigahertz (Ghz) and 300 Ghz. Researchers are testing 5G wireless broadband technology on millimeter wave spectrum.Continue Reading
optoisolator (optical coupler or optocoupler)
An optoisolator (also optical coupler or optocoupler) is a component that uses light to transfer electrical signals between circuits to keep them electrically isolated from each other, preventing surges.Continue Reading
